#41514f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#41514f is composed of 25.5% red, 31.8%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.5%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 172.5 degrees, a saturation of 11% and a lightness of 28.6%. #41514f color hex could be obtained by blending #82a29e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#41514f color description : Very dark grayish cyan.
#41514f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#41514f has RGB values of R:65, G:81,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4280655.
